❓ Question on Notice 1640 reveals median wait times for primary school children accessing audiology, speech pathology, physiotherapy, and occupational therapy services provided by WA Country Health Service.
AnsweredQoN 1640Legislative Council
QuestionView source ↗
I refer to child development services provided by the WA Country Health Service, will the Minister advise the current median wait times for children, in
the primary years of schooling, to access the following services: (a) audiology; (b) speech pathology; (c) physiotherapy; and (d) occupational therapy?

AnswerView source ↗
Answered
14 November 2023
Responded by
Leader of the House representing the Minister for Health
Response time
11 days
Discipline
Median Wait time (days)
Audiology
126
Speech Pathology
56
Physiotherapy
49
Occupational Therapy
60
